Q: Is 2,709,270 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,709,270 is a composite number.

Why is 2,709,270 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,709,270 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 9 10 15 18 30 45 90 30,103 60,206 90,309 150,515 180,618 270,927 301,030 451,545 541,854 903,090 1,354,635 and 2,709,270, with no remainder.

Since 2,709,270 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,709,270, it is a composite number.
